Europe's largest cell phone company has sold one million of its flagship Live! camera-equipped phones in just five months.

Vodafone's sales eclipse those of Anglo-French rival Orange, the top mobile group in Britain and France by customers.

Orange says it sold 330,000 picture phones by the end of January, having brought them onto market last August.
